Guest User

Untitled

a guest
Jun 14th, 2018
144
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
PHP 2.47 KB | None | 0 0
  1.                 <?
  2. /**
  3.  * User has already logged in, so display relavent links, including
  4.  * a link to the admin center if the user is an administrator.
  5.  */
  6. if($session->logged_in){
  7.    echo "<h1>Logged In</h1>";
  8.    echo "Welcome <b>$session->username</b>, you are logged in. <br><br>"
  9.        ."[<a href=\"userinfo.php?user=$session->username\">My Account</a>] &nbsp;&nbsp;"
  10.        ."[<a href=\"useredit.php\">Edit Account</a>] &nbsp;&nbsp;";
  11.    if($session->isAdmin()){
  12.       echo "[<a href=\"admin/admin.php\">Admin Center</a>] &nbsp;&nbsp;";
  13.    }
  14.    echo "[<a href=\"process.php\">Logout</a>]";
  15. }
  16. else{
  17. ?>
  18.  
  19. <h1>Login</h1>
  20. <?
  21. /**
  22.  * User not logged in, display the login form.
  23.  * If user has already tried to login, but errors were
  24.  * found, display the total number of errors.
  25.  * If errors occurred, they will be displayed.
  26.  */
  27. if($form->num_errors > 0){
  28.    echo "<font size=\"2\" color=\"#ff0000\">".$form->num_errors." error(s) found</font>";
  29. }
  30. ?>
  31. <form action="process.php" method="POST">
  32. <table align="left" border="0" cellspacing="0" cellpadding="3">
  33. <tr><td>Username:</td><td><input type="text" name="user" maxlength="30" value="<? echo $form->value("user"); ?>"></td><td><? echo $form->error("user"); ?></td></tr>
  34. <tr><td>Password:</td><td><input type="password" name="pass" maxlength="30" value="<? echo $form->value("pass"); ?>"></td><td><? echo $form->error("pass"); ?></td></tr>
  35. <tr><td colspan="2" align="left"><input type="checkbox" name="remember" <? if($form->value("remember") != ""){ echo "checked"; } ?>>
  36. <font size="2">Remember me next time &nbsp;&nbsp;&nbsp;&nbsp;
  37. <input type="hidden" name="sublogin" value="1">
  38. <input type="submit" value="Login"></td></tr>
  39. <tr><td colspan="2" align="left"><br><font size="2">[<a href="forgotpass.php">Forgot Password?</a>]</font></td><td align="right"></td></tr>
  40. <tr><td colspan="2" align="left"><br>Not registered? <a href="register.php">Sign-Up!</a></td></tr>
  41. </table>
  42. </form>
  43. <?
  44. }
  45.  
  46. /**
  47.  * Just a little page footer, tells how many registered members
  48.  * there are, how many users currently logged in and viewing site,
  49.  * and how many guests viewing site. Active users are displayed,
  50.  * with link to their user information.
  51.  */
  52. echo "</td></tr><tr><td align=\"center\"><br><br>";
  53. echo "<b>Member Total:</b> ".$database->getNumMembers()."<br>";
  54. echo "There are $database->num_active_users registered members and ";
  55. echo "$database->num_active_guests guests viewing the site.<br><br>";
  56.  
  57. include("include/view_active.php");
  58.  
  59. ?>
Add Comment
Please, Sign In to add comment